Types of Vintage Glassware for Cocktails
Martini Glasses
Martini glasses are iconic in the world of cocktails. Vintage martini glasses, often with elegant stems and intricate designs, can elevate the classic martini to new heights. Their V-shaped bowl allows the cocktail to be sipped without warming it with your hands, maintaining the perfect temperature and flavor.
Coupes and Saucers
Coupe glasses, with their shallow bowls and wide rims, are perfect for serving sparkling wines and cocktails like the French 75 or the Sidecar. Vintage coupes often feature beautiful etchings and delicate stems, adding a touch of sophistication to any drink. They also allow for a greater surface area, enhancing the aroma and overall sensory experience.
Highball and Collins Glasses
Highball and Collins glasses, with their tall and cylindrical shape, are ideal for cocktails served with a lot of ice, such as the Gin and Tonic or the Tom Collins. Vintage highball glasses often come in vibrant colors and bold patterns, adding a playful and retro vibe to your cocktail presentation.
Old-Fashioned Glasses
Old-fashioned glasses, also known as rocks glasses, are short and sturdy, perfect for serving whiskey-based cocktails like the Old Fashioned or the Negroni. Vintage rock glasses often feature thick bases and intricate cut designs, providing a tactile and visual delight that enhances the drinking experience.
Punch Bowls and Cups
For those who enjoy entertaining, vintage punch bowls and cups are a must-have. These pieces often come in elaborate designs and large sets, making them perfect for serving communal drinks like punch or sangria. The visual impact of a beautifully crafted punch bowl filled with a colorful cocktail can be a showstopper at any gathering.
How to Care for Vintage Glassware\
Cleaning and Maintenance
Proper care is essential to maintain the beauty and integrity of vintage glassware. Hand washing is recommended to avoid damage from dishwashers. Use a mild detergent and warm water, and dry the glasses immediately with a soft cloth to prevent water spots and mineral deposits.
Storage Tips
Store vintage glassware in a safe place, preferably in a cabinet with glass doors to protect them from dust while allowing you to display them. Use soft liners or pads to cushion the bases and prevent scratches. Avoid stacking glasses to prevent chipping and cracking.
Handling Precautions
Handle vintage glassware with care, especially when it's wet, as it can become slippery. Hold glasses by the bowl or base, rather than the rim, to avoid stressing delicate areas. Regularly inspect your glassware for any cracks or chips, and retire any damaged pieces to avoid injury.
Where to Find Vintage Glassware
Antique shops and flea markets are treasure troves for vintage glassware. Take your time exploring these places, as you may find unique and rare pieces not available elsewhere. Donβt hesitate to ask the vendors about the history and origin of the pieces you are interested in.
Online marketplaces like eBay, Etsy, and specialized vintage glassware websites offer a wide selection of pieces from different eras and styles. Make sure to read the descriptions carefully and check the sellerβs ratings and reviews before making a purchase.
Estate sales and auctions are excellent opportunities to find high-quality vintage glassware, often at reasonable prices. These events can offer a wide variety of pieces, from complete sets to individual glasses. Keep an eye out for local listings and be prepared to bid competitively for the best pieces.
